My Ultimate Quest: The Great American Baseball Card Flipping Trading & Bubble Gum Book. I found this book on a sales rack in a bookstore when I was 11 or 12, and read it cover-to-cover religiously. For those of you that haven't read it, see if you can dig up a copy, 'cause this book is what OBC is all about. It is written by 2 guys who grew up in the 50's & 60's that collected cards, and reminisces on some of the distinctive & less than stellar ballplayers of that time. It's very well written, and my eternal thanks go out to Chuck Paris, who actually tracked down another copy for me, since my original is in Tipton VG at this point! So why am I telling you all this? There are cards of every player they speak about (except Eddie Gaedel) featured in this book, & ever since I bought the book I dreamed of a day when I might get 'em all. Told to & compiled by Lawrence S. Ritter (ex-OBCer Larry Ritter?) the book contains "the story of the early days of baseball told by the men who played it." I picked it up in a Harvard used book store about 4 years ago, and it is a fantastic read. The challenges & experiences these players had compared to the game they saw played through the 50's & 60's is perspective enough on how much the game has evolved, much less compared to the millionaires of today. I'm working on a Master Set of 1953 Topps. All I need are a few more pesky 'bio variations'. The middle series (and the SPs) were printed two ways: the home/birthplace/height data appears in black and in white.
